Liverpool's players have been accused of lacking heart in an amazing outburst by Olimpija Ljubljana striker Mladen Rudonja just days before the two teams meet at Anfield.
The Reds drew 1-1 in Slovenia last month and qualification for the 2nd round of the UEFA Cup will be decided on Wednesday but in an astonishing interview, Rudonja has rubbished the Premiership team.
"Their big players may have lots of money - but that means nothing on the pitch," claimed Rudonja. "You need to have heart and they haven't got it like we have. We're not bothered by them. Every footballer has two legs just like me so why should I say they are better players. If they think they are, they are free to prove it on the pitch."
Rudonja wasn't the only one to have a pop at Liverpool though. The Slovenian team's manager, Suad Besirovic, also had something to say. "If we played Liverpool every week, we'd be top of our league by 20 points," he insisted. "We're going to England with the intention of winning and going into the next round. After seeing Liverpool in action, I know we are capable of that."
